Basic Copy Editing
Ideal for manuscripts that are structurally sound but need language refinement
Basic copy editing — also called line editing or language editing — is the essential first tier of professional editing. It focuses on correcting errors at the sentence level: grammar, spelling, punctuation, verb tense consistency, subject-verb agreement, and awkward phrasing. This level of editing does not restructure your chapters or rewrite your narrative — it polishes and clarifies the prose you have already written.
Copy editing is particularly valuable for authors who have already revised their manuscript multiple times and are confident in the structure but want a professional eye to catch the errors that inevitably slip through self-editing. It is also the standard requirement for manuscripts being submitted to Indian publishers, literary agents, and self-publishing platforms like Amazon KDP.

Developmental Editing
The most intensive editorial service — ideal for early-stage manuscripts or complex books
Developmental editing — also known as structural editing or big-picture editing — is the most comprehensive and transformative editorial service available. It is designed for manuscripts that are still in development, where significant restructuring, expansion, or reconceptualisation may be required. A developmental editor does not just polish your words — they work with you as a collaborative partner to reshape the entire architecture of your book.
In fiction, developmental editing addresses plot holes, character arcs, subplot integration, point of view inconsistencies, and narrative tension. In non-fiction, it focuses on argument structure, chapter sequencing, evidence quality, thesis clarity, and the overall persuasive logic of the book. The developmental editor produces a detailed editorial letter — sometimes 10 to 20 pages — outlining every major finding and recommendation. What is the difference between copy editing and developmental editing? +
Copy editing focuses on the sentence level — correcting grammar, spelling, punctuation, and improving sentence clarity without changing the structure of your manuscript. Developmental editing, on the other hand, is a big-picture service that examines the overall architecture of your book: the chapter structure, narrative arc, argument development, character consistency, pacing, and logical flow. Copy editing makes your existing manuscript cleaner. Developmental editing may suggest significant restructuring, addition, or removal of sections to make the book fundamentally stronger. Most authors benefit from developmental editing first, followed by copy editing once the structure is finalised.

What is proofreading and is it different from editing? +
Proofreading is the final stage of the editorial process and is distinct from editing. While editing (at any level) addresses language quality, structure, and style, proofreading is a final quality-check performed after editing is complete. A proofreader looks for any remaining typographical errors, formatting inconsistencies, missing words, doubled words, and layout issues that may have been introduced during the editing and typesetting process. Proofreading should always be the last step before your manuscript goes to print or is uploaded to a publishing platform. We recommend both editing and proofreading for any manuscript destined for publication.

What is scientific editing and who needs it? +
Scientific editing is a specialised form of professional editing designed for research papers, academic books, technical reports, medical manuscripts, and STEM publications. It goes beyond standard language editing to ensure that technical terminology is used correctly and consistently, that research methodology descriptions are clear and replicable, that citations and references are properly formatted, and that the overall argument meets the standards of academic peer review. Scientific editing is essential for researchers, academics, and professionals preparing manuscripts for journal submission, academic publishers, or conference proceedings.
